• Mutations in the genes encoding isocitrate dehydrogenase, IDH1 and IDH2, have been reported in gliomas, myeloid leukemias, chondrosarcomas and thyroid cancer. (nih.gov)
  • We identified 2309 genes that were significantly hypermethylated in 19 cholangiocarcinomas with mutations in IDH1 or IDH2, compared with cholangiocarcinomas without these mutations. (nih.gov)
  • Half of the hypermethylated genes overlapped with DNA hypermethylation in IDH1-mutant gliobastomas, suggesting the existence of a common set of genes whose expression may be affected by mutations in IDH1 or IDH2 in different types of tumors. (nih.gov)

  • EKVP can be caused by mutations in several genes, including GJB3 , GJB4 , and GJA1 . (medlineplus.gov)
  • The GJB3 , GJB4 , and GJA1 gene mutations that lead to EKVP alter the structure or location of the connexins produced from these genes. (medlineplus.gov)
  • In some cases, people with EKVP do not have a known mutation in one of the three connexin genes described above. (medlineplus.gov)

  • Substitution mutations can be either silent, missense or nonsense. (ukessays.com)
  • A missense mutation results in the generation of a codon that encodes for a different amino acid than the template strand would have produced. (ukessays.com)
  • Both missense and nonsense mutations result in an incorrect, and likely dysfunctional, polypeptide structure, and can be caused by a number of various errors in DNA replication. (ukessays.com)

  • Sometimes mutations occur during replication due to interactions of DNA with the environment. (ukessays.com)
  • This occurs through deamination, where the hydrolysis of cytosine, turning it into uracil, causes the base to mispair with adenine during replication, and ultimately be replaced by thymine. (ukessays.com)
  • Depurination is another process that results in a single base mutation during replication. (ukessays.com)

  • We found that tumor cells in 90 percent of the patients we tested contained a single point mutation, an error in one of the bases that make up the 'rungs' of the DNA helix," says Steven Treon, MD, PhD, who led the research with his Dana-Farber colleague Zachary Hunter. (sciencedaily.com)
  • Ninety percent of the tumor cells had a point mutation in the gene MYD88. (sciencedaily.com)
  • The mutation causes the cells to produce a distorted protein, which switches on the IRAK complex pathway, leading to activation of NF-kB, a protein that is essential for the growth and survival of Waldenström's tumor cells," Treon comments. (sciencedaily.com)

  • In general, activating EGFR mutations are more commonly observed in patients with adenocarcinomas and no prior history of smoking, as well as in females and those of Asian descent. (medscape.com)
  • [ 7 ] researchers identified EGFR mutations in 50.5% of surgically resected lung adenocarcinomas. (medscape.com)
  • [ 8 ] These data support estimates from clinical trial evidence that activating EGFR mutations are seen in approximately 50% of Asians and 10% of non-Asians. (medscape.com)
  • Use of the EGFR-TKIs gefitinib, erlotinib, and afatinib is limited to patients with adenocarcinomas who have known activating EGFR mutations. (medscape.com)
  • As discussed below, activity of the EGFR monoclonal antibody cetuximab seems to be independent of EGFR mutation status. (medscape.com)
  • It is unclear how the presence of an acquired EGFR mutation such as T790M should influence therapeutic decisions. (medscape.com)
  • [ 9 ] Most importantly, patients with KRAS mutations seem to have a poorer prognosis and seem to be resistant to EGFR-TKIs, although the extent to which this might influence treatment selection remains somewhat unclear. (medscape.com)
  • Because EGFR and ALK mutations are mutually exclusive, patients with ALK rearrangements are not thought to benefit from EGFR-targeting TKIs. (medscape.com)
